在企业IT管理中,评估效能提升效果是确保技术投资回报的关键步骤。本文将从定义效能指标、选择评估方法、设定基准线与目标、收集和分析数据、识别潜在问题以及制定改进措施六个方面,系统性地探讨如何科学评估效能提升的效果,并提供可操作的建议。
一、定义效能指标
-
明确效能的核心维度
效能评估的第一步是定义清晰的效能指标。这些指标应涵盖响应时间、吞吐量、资源利用率、用户满意度等关键维度。例如,在IT系统中,响应时间可以衡量系统处理请求的速度,而吞吐量则反映系统在单位时间内处理的任务量。 -
结合业务目标定制指标
效能指标应与企业的业务目标紧密相关。例如,如果企业的目标是提升客户体验,那么用户满意度和系统可用性可能成为核心指标;如果目标是降低成本,则资源利用率和能耗效率可能更为重要。 -
避免指标过多或过少
指标过多可能导致分析复杂化,而过少则可能无法全面反映效能。建议选择5-7个核心指标,既能覆盖关键维度,又便于管理和分析。
二、选择评估方法
-
定量与定性方法结合
定量方法(如性能测试、日志分析)可以提供客观数据,而定性方法(如用户反馈、专家评估)则能捕捉主观体验。例如,通过A/B测试可以量化不同配置下的性能差异,而通过用户访谈可以了解实际使用中的痛点。 -
选择合适的工具
根据评估需求选择工具。例如,APM(应用性能管理)工具可以实时监控系统性能,而问卷调查工具则适合收集用户反馈。 -
考虑评估的持续性与周期性
效能评估不应是一次性的,而应是持续的过程。建议采用定期评估与事件触发评估相结合的方式,例如每季度进行一次全面评估,同时在系统升级或业务高峰期后进行专项评估。
三、设定基准线与目标
-
建立基准线
基准线是评估效能提升的基础。通过收集系统在优化前的性能数据,可以建立一个历史基准线。例如,如果优化前的平均响应时间为2秒,那么2秒就是基准线。 -
设定合理目标
目标应具有挑战性但可实现。例如,可以将目标设定为“将响应时间降低30%”或“将资源利用率提升至80%”。目标应遵循SMART原则(具体、可衡量、可实现、相关性、时限性)。 -
考虑外部因素
在设定目标时,需考虑外部因素(如业务增长、技术趋势)的影响。例如,如果预计业务量将增长20%,那么目标应相应调整。
四、收集和分析数据
-
数据收集的全面性
数据收集应覆盖所有相关维度。例如,在评估系统性能时,不仅要收集CPU、内存等硬件数据,还要收集用户行为数据和业务指标。 -
数据分析的科学性
使用统计方法和可视化工具(如折线图、柱状图)分析数据。例如,通过趋势分析可以发现性能变化的规律,而通过相关性分析可以识别影响效能的关键因素。 -
关注异常数据
异常数据往往能揭示潜在问题。例如,如果某段时间的响应时间突然增加,可能是由于系统负载过高或代码缺陷。
五、识别潜在问题
-
性能瓶颈的定位
通过数据分析定位性能瓶颈。例如,如果数据库查询时间过长,可能是索引设计不合理或查询语句效率低下。 -
用户痛点的挖掘
通过用户反馈和日志分析挖掘用户痛点。例如,如果用户频繁抱怨系统卡顿,可能是前端渲染效率低下或网络延迟过高。 -
外部因素的干扰
识别外部因素(如网络波动、第三方服务故障)对效能的影响。例如,如果系统依赖的外部API响应时间不稳定,可能需要优化接口调用逻辑。
六、制定改进措施
-
技术优化
针对性能瓶颈进行技术优化。例如,通过代码重构、数据库优化或硬件升级提升系统性能。 -
流程改进
优化工作流程以提高效率。例如,通过自动化部署减少人为错误,或通过敏捷开发加快迭代速度。 -
持续监控与反馈
建立持续监控机制,确保改进措施的效果。例如,通过实时监控仪表盘跟踪关键指标,并通过定期复盘总结经验教训。 -
团队培训与文化建设
提升团队的技术能力和效能意识。例如,通过技术培训提升开发人员的性能优化能力,或通过文化建设鼓励团队关注效能提升。
评估效能提升效果是一个系统性工程,需要从定义指标、选择方法、设定目标到数据分析、问题识别和改进措施的全流程管理。通过科学的评估和持续的优化,企业可以确保IT投资的很大化回报,并为业务增长提供坚实的技术支撑。在实践中,建议结合具体场景灵活调整评估策略,同时注重团队协作和文化建设,以实现效能的持续提升。
原创文章,作者:hiI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/233794